Nancy and Karl have a house on a golf course in a gated community in northwest San Antonio. I think that if they had it to do over again, they would rethink the whole "golf course" idea. Nancy got the house partially because her mother played golf and a course at the bottom of the street where they lived in Arlington, so I assume that being near the course had some familiarity value. But I am pretty sure that it wasn't long after they moved in that Nancy discovered that living near a golf course is somewhat different from living on one, as the experience of a few broken windows and numerous broken roof tiles has probably shown.
But the course does provide an excellent place to walk (something Nancy likes to do), and after we ate supper most of us went out to the course to stroll along its cartways. For my part, I thought the sunset inspirational enough to just lie back on one of the artificial hills and enjoy the colors of the sky:
